- Sad news, we have Breaking Changes.
-
SetDefaultEngineId()
replaced bySetDefaultModelId()
-
RetrieveModel(modelId)
will not use the default Model anymore. You have to pass modelId as a parameter. - I implemented Model overwrite logic.
- If you pass a modelId as a parameter it will overwrite the Default Model Id and object modelId
- If you pass your modelId in your object it will overwrite the Default Model Id
- If you don't pass any modelId it will use Default Model Id
- If you didn't set a Default Model Id, SDK will throw a null argument exception
- Parameter Model Id > Object Model Id > Default Model Id
- If you find this complicated please have a look at the implementation, OpenAI.SDK/Extensions/ModelExtension.cs -> ProcessModelId()

-
Breaking change.
-
EmbeddingCreateRequest.Input
was a string list type now it is a string type.
I have introducedInputAsList
property instead ofInput
. You may need to update your code according the change.
Both Input(string) and InputAsList(string list) avaliable for use
-
-
Added string and string List support for some of the propertis.
- CompletionCreateRequest --> Prompt & PromptAsList / Stop & StopAsList
- CreateModerationRequest --> Input & InputAsList
- EmbeddingCreateRequest --> Input & InputAsList
